The Vistula Lagoon (Polish: Zalew Wiślany; Russian: Калининградский залив, transliterated: Kaliningradskiy Zaliv; German: Frisches Haff; Lithuanian: Aistmarės) is a brackish water lagoon on the Baltic Sea roughly 56 miles (90 km) long, 6 to 15 miles (10 to 19 km) wide, and up to 17 feet (5 m) deep, … See more
